Output 026f37632fceeaf0dca039258cdd622bd67e6fc4e0e68ebe487b3f5c6fc0863a:25

value
1603635
script pubkey
OP_0 OP_PUSHBYTES_20 8bbf17526423ccdfdc230051871d8d263c057dcc
address
ltc1q3wl3w5nyy0xdlhprqpgcw8vdyc7q2lwv2kfjps
transaction
026f37632fceeaf0dca039258cdd622bd67e6fc4e0e68ebe487b3f5c6fc0863a
spent
true